Logical replication from multiple masters - master starvation

[Date Prev][Date Next][Thread Prev][Thread Next][Date Index][Thread Index]

 



Hi everyone,

I'm using postgres 11.4
I have a configuration in which there's one subscriber (slave) node which subscribes to several (4) publisher nodes (master).
I noticed one of the master servers keeps lagging behind. I noticed that the replication worker on the master keeps failing on timeouts. 
When querying pg_stat_subscription on the slave I noticed that last_msg_send_time for this master hardly ever updates. 

Could this be starvation? 
Is there any special configuration on either side (master/slave) that can help reduce that?
What's the logic on the slave that chooses from which subscription to process incoming data?
How can I further debug this?
